Many Hyde Park Theatre regulars will remember Hamell's one-man show, "Driving All Night: How to Raise a Kid and Survive as a Broke-Ass Musician" which premiered on our stage last fall and also ran as part of FronteraFest BYOV.
Armed with a battered 1937 Gibson acoustic guitar that he amplifies mightily and strums like a machine gun, a politically astute mind that can't stop moving, and a mouth that can be profane one minute and profound the next, Hamell shoots straight with his audience, whether unraveling topical issues or sharing confessional tales from his own past.
In addition to world-class songwriting, a Hamell show is a multidisciplinary experience drawing from the worlds of theatre, stand-up comedy and storytelling earning him the coveted Herald Angel Award at the Edinburgh Fringe Festival. His performances invoke thoughts of the great rebellious satirists and social commentators of the past, from Lenny Bruce to Richard Pryor to Bill Hicks.
